How to Install and Use Opera GX on Windows 11
Before we begin, make sure you have a stable internet connection to download the browser. The installation process is quick, and once installed, you can start using Opera GX right away with its default settings or customize it to your liking.
1. Download Opera GX on Windows 11
To get started, you first need to download the Opera GX installer from the official website.
- Open your preferred browser on your Windows 11 PC.
- Go to the official Opera GX website.
- Click on the Download Opera GX button.
- Wait for the setup file to download completely.
- Once downloaded, locate the installer file in your Downloads folder.
2. Install Opera GX on Your PC
After downloading the installer, you can proceed with installing Opera GX on your system.
- Double-click the downloaded Opera GX setup file to launch the installer.
- If prompted, click Yes to allow the app to make changes to your device.
- Click on Install to begin the installation process.
- You can also select Options to customize installation settings like location or default browser preferences.
- Wait for the installation to complete, and Opera GX will launch automatically.
3. Set Up Opera GX for First-Time Use
Once installed, Opera GX will guide you through a quick setup process to personalize your experience.
- When Opera GX opens, choose your preferred theme and color scheme.
- Select whether you want to import data like bookmarks and history from another browser.
- Sign in to your Opera account if you want to sync your data across devices.
- Explore the sidebar for quick access to features like messaging apps and GX Control.
- Finish the setup and start browsing.
4. Use GX Control to Limit CPU and RAM Usage
One of the standout features of Opera GX is GX Control, which allows you to limit how much system resources the browser uses.
- Open Opera GX and click on the GX Control icon from the sidebar.
- Enable the RAM Limiter and set the maximum memory usage.
- Turn on the CPU Limiter and adjust the usage percentage.
- Optionally, enable the Network Limiter to control bandwidth usage.
- Apply the settings and continue browsing with better performance control.
5. Customize the Look and Features of Opera GX
Opera GX is highly customizable, allowing you to change its appearance and behavior to match your style.
- Click on the Easy Setup icon in the top-right corner of the browser.
- Choose themes, wallpapers, and accent colors.
- Enable or disable features like background music and sound effects.
- Add extensions from the Chrome Web Store if needed.
- Adjust settings to create your ideal browsing experience.
6. Explore Built-in Features of Opera GX
Opera GX comes with several built-in tools that enhance your browsing experience without needing additional extensions.
- Use the GX Cleaner to clear cache and free up space.
- Access messaging apps like WhatsApp and Telegram directly from the sidebar.
- Enable the built-in ad blocker for a cleaner browsing experience.
- Use the VPN feature for added privacy while browsing.
- Check out GX Corner for gaming news, deals, and updates.
